Step-by-Step Guide on How to Train Your Dog to Speak English

Basic Techniques

Training your dog to speak English can be a fun and rewarding experience. Here are some basic techniques to get started:

  1. Start with simple commands such as sit, stay, and come
  2. Use treats as positive reinforcement
  3. Repeat commands regularly and consistently

Advanced Techniques

Once your dog has mastered the basic commands, you can move on to more advanced techniques to teach them to speak English:

  1. Introduce new vocabulary words gradually
  2. Practice commands in different environments to build consistency
  3. Use hand gestures or visual cues to reinforce verbal commands

Tips for Overcoming Common Challenges in Training

Training a dog to speak English may not always be easy, but with the right approach, you can overcome common challenges. Here are some tips to help you along the way:

  • Be patient and consistent with your training sessions
  • Use positive reinforcement techniques such as treats and praise
  • Avoid using harsh punishments or yelling, as this can confuse and intimidate your dog
